一种cttb信号与卫星信号相结合的定位方法

文档序号:6158922阅读:509来源:国知局
专利名称:一种cttb信号与卫星信号相结合的定位方法
技术领域
本发明涉及一种通过接收GPS卫星(也可是其他定位卫星)信号和CTTB数字电 视信号确定接收机空间位置的定位方法,其特征是能提高可见GPS卫星(也可是其他定位 卫星)数目不足四颗时的定位概率和可见GPS卫星(也可是其他定位卫星)数目充足时的 较GPS (也可是其他定位系统)接收机更高精度的定位。
背景技术
目前,定位系统多是通过定位卫星实现的,例如美国的全球定位系统(GPS)、欧洲 的伽利略(Galileo)系统、俄罗斯的GL0NASS系统以及我国的北斗系统等等。只要接收到 四颗以上的卫星信号,它们就可以通过接收处理卫星发射的伪随机码信号,进而确定用户 位置、速度和时间等信息。但是由于卫星从20000公里左右的高空以相对较低的功率向地 面发射信号,使得接收机接收到的信号强度很弱,很容易受到干扰的影响,在有楼房遮挡的 市区和室内时,很难定位甚至根本无法实现定位。自2006年8月我国颁布《数字电视地面广播传输系统帧结构、信道编码和调制》 国家标准,并于2007年8月1日开始实施以来,地面数字电视产业在我国获得了蓬勃的发 展,目前国内300个地级城市的地面数字电视频道规划已经完成。2009年广电总局首次公 开发布了中国地面数字电视标准英文标识为CTTB。用户接收端通过接收地面数字电视信号除了可实现视频音频节目欣赏外,还可以 利用其数字码流确定从电视信号发射塔到接收机的距离,实现无线定位功能。由于地面数 字电视将覆盖全国各个县市,而且频谱资源丰富、发射功率大,与卫星导航信号相比,可以 抵抗更强的干扰,在有高楼遮挡卫星信号的市区和室内仍然可以实现定位功能。但是,如果定位只通过地面数字电视信号实现,那么至少需要4个电视信号发射 站才能实现3维的定位功能。我国的地面数字电视广播网将通过在城市内组成单频网来提 高数字电视信号的覆盖率,但是根据我国目前的城市规模和现阶段地面电视覆盖率测试和 单频网试验情况,大多数城市并不需要四个或更多电视信号发射站来实现区域无缝覆盖。 由于电视信号发射站数目不足四个时无法单独实现定位功能,使得单独通过地面数字电视 信号实现定位在大多数地区并无法真正实现。本发明在不影响地面数字电视广播正常发射 和被电视节目用户接收的前提下,根据CTTB信号的特点,充分利用地面数字电视发射站及 其发射的CTTB信号和GPS卫星(也可是其它定位卫星)及其发射信号,实现高成功概率的 定位和高精度的定位。

发明内容
为了解决由于市区建筑物等遮挡导致的可见GPS卫星(也可是其他定位卫星)不 足而无法定位的问题,本发明提供了一种利用CTTB与GPS卫星(也可是其他定位卫星)信 号相结合的定位方法,有效利用电视信号发射站与GPS卫星(也可是其他定位卫星)相结 合,提高可见GPS卫星(也可是其他定位卫星)不足情况下的定位概率,并在可定位条件下获得更高的定位精度。本发明既适用于单频网环境下多电视信号发射站的情况,又适用于 单电视信号发射站的情况。本发明提供的定位方法其步骤为接收机接收GPS卫星(也可是其他定位卫星) 信号,并进行信号处理,获得可见GPS卫星(也可是其他定位卫星)的位置,伪距信息;接收 机接收CTTB信号,确定其电视信号发射站,和与电视信号发射站之间的伪距信息;接收机 根据与GPS卫星(也可是其他定位卫星)伪距及相应的卫星坐标、与电视信号发射站伪距 及相应的电视信号发射站坐标对接收机进行空间位置的定位。其中,获得可见GPS卫星(也可是其他定位卫星)的位置,伪距信息的方法,与现 有GPS接收机方法相同。其中,接收机接收CTTB信号,确定其电视发射站主要针对单频网情况,即在一个 城市内存在多个电视信号发射站。确定接收CTTB信号来自哪个电视信号发射站采用的方 法为根据接收机存储的位置信息或在开阔区域通过GPS(也可是其他卫星定位系统)得到 的位置信息,对照接收机存储器存储的地理信息,确定接收机所在城市、所在城市各频段发 射CTTB信号的模式、所在城市电视信号发射站个数、相应的位置坐标及相对于接收机的方 向。接收天线根据接收CTTB信号的到达方向即可判断出接收到的CTTB信号是由哪个电视 信号发射站发出及其电视信号发射站的坐标。其中,确定接收机与电视信号发射站之间的伪距,是通过测量到的CTTB信号帧在 电视信号发射站和接收机之间的传播时间计算的。接收机在任意请求定位时刻,接收CTTB 信号。计算接收CTTB信号时刻与CTTB日帧复位参考时间(如北京时间00:00:00AM)之 间整数信号帧(如果天线接收频段CTTB信号为模式一信号帧长度为555. 56 μ s,模式二为 578. 7 μ s,模式三为625 μ s)的个数,对此数加1并对超帧中信号帧个数进行取模运算,根 据得到的数值判定信号帧序号,确定本地PN序列。将接收的CTTB信号与本地PN序列进行 相关,得到相关峰值的位置即为信号帧帧头位置,根据接收信号到帧头位置之间移位符号 的个数确定接收到帧头的时间。此接收帧头的发射时间为接收CTTB信号时刻与CTTB日帧 复位参考时间(如北京时间00:00:00AM)之间整数信号帧的个数加1值与信号帧长度的乘 积。用帧头接收时间减去发射时间,即可得到CTTB信号帧在发射站和接收机之间的传播时 间,传播时间与光速相乘,就得到接收机与电视发射站之间的伪距值。其中,对接收机进行定位即对接收机位置的求解,利用所有可见GPS卫星(也可是 其他定位卫星)及其与接收机之间伪距和CTTB电视信号发射站及其与接收机之间伪距,采 用同GPS定位(也可是其他卫星定位系统)计算接收机位置相同的方法即可获得接收机位 置和时间、速度等信息。当GPS卫星(也可是其他定位卫星)数目与CTTB电视信号发射站 数目之和不足四时,无法完成定位,当和大于四时可实现定位。本发明的有益效果是,可以在GPS卫星(也可是其他定位卫星)可见数目不足四 颗情况下提高定位概率,在可定位情况下获得尽可能高的定位精度。可用于存在单频网的 城市环境,开且对单频网中电视信号发射站的数目没有要求,同时本发明也可用于非单频 网单电视信号发射站的环境。


图1是CTTB的四层帧结构图。
图2是CTTB的信号帧结构图。图3是CTTB的信号帧模式一和模式三的帧头结构图。图4是CTTB的信号帧模式二的帧头结构图。图5是定位原理示意图。
具体实施例方式下面结合附图对本发明的具体实施方式
作进一步的详细描述。由于本发明不对电 视信号发射站发射的CTTB信号作任何改动,因此本发明只涉及到接收机部分的设计。接收 机的工作包括以下步骤1)根据接收机存储的位置信息,可以是断电前的位置或者上一次定位的位置,或 者是在开阔区域通过GPS (也可是其他卫星定位系统)得到的位置信息,对照接收机存储器 存储的地理信息确定接收机所在的城市、所在城市各频段发射的CTTB信号的模式、所在城 市电视发射站个数、相应的位置坐标及相对于接收机的方向。2)通过天线捕获GPS卫星(也可是其他定位卫星)发射的射频信号,分辨可见卫 星发出的信号。通过天线接收某一频段CTTB信号并记录信号的到达方向,信号到达时间。 对于接收CTTB信号频段的选择可以根据接收机天线的接收频率范围、特定频段CTTB信号 帧的帧模式如图2所示、以及各频段的噪声情况进行综合判断选取。3)对捕获的GPS卫星(也可是其他定位卫星)信号进行跟踪,提取导航电文,解码 导航电文,确定卫星位置、速度和时钟参数。按照传统GPS (也可是其他卫星定位系统)接 收机的工作原理实现信号从卫星到接收机传输时间的测量。4)通过接收CTTB信号的不同方向,判定其发射站。当可见卫星数目和电视发射站 数目之和大于等于4时执行步骤5),当可见卫星数目和电视发射站数目之和小于4时执行 步骤2)或通知不可定位。5)确定CTTB信号帧在电视信号发射站和接收机之间的传播时间。确定CTTB信号 帧在电视信号发射站和接收机之间的传播时间采用的方法为对不同方向到达的CTTB信 号计算CTTB信号到达时刻V与CTTB日帧复位参考时间t (如北京时间00:00:00AM)之 间整数信号帧(如果天线接收频段CTTB信号为模式一,信号帧长度为555. 56μ s,模式二为 578. 7 μ s,模式三为625 μ s)的个数,对此数加1,所得结果记为k。若天线接收频段CTTB 模式为模式一或模式三时,由于帧头PN序列存在相位变化,因此无法直接确定用来与接收 信号进行相关运算的本地PN序列,需要令k对超帧中信号帧个数(如果天线接收频段CTTB 信号帧模式为模式一此数为225,模式三此数为200)进行取模运算,得到的数值即为信号 帧帧头序号,进而根据帧头序号确定天线接收频段CTTB模式所对应的帧头PN序列,并按照 其信号帧模式对其进行如图3所示前同步和后同步的循环扩展,得到本地PN序列。若天线 接收频段CTTB信号帧模式为模式二,由于不存在帧头PN序列相位变化,因此可以直接确定 帧头PN序列,如图4所示该帧头PN序列无需进行循环扩展,可直接作为本地PN序列。将 接收到的CTTB信号与本地PN序列进行相关,相关得到峰值的位置即为信号帧帧头所在位 置%,根据接收信号到帧头位置之间移位符号的个数确定接收到帧头的时间、、=、' +B1 · Ts式中Ts为符号长度,Ts= l/fs,fs为符号率,在DTMB中仁为7. 56Msps。而此接收帧头在电视信号发射站的发射时间、为k与信号帧帧长度(如果天线接收频段CTTB信号 为模式一信号帧长度为555. 56 μ s,模式二为578. 7 μ s,模式三为625 μ s)的乘积,即t0 = t+k · T其中T为信号帧长度,对于模式一 T = 555. 56 μ s,对于模式二 T = 578. 7 μ s,对 于模式三T = 625 μ S。用帧头接收时间tl减去发射时间、,即可得到CTTB信号帧在发射 站和接收机之间的传播时间。6)将GPS卫星(也可是其他定位卫星)信号到接收机的传输时间和电视信号发射 站到接收机CTTB信号的传播时间与光速相乘获得伪距值。将幻和幻中获得的信息同伪 距值一起代入位置、速度、时间估算方程,计算出接收机的空间位置坐标,并换算为接收机 的定位信息,包括位置、速度和时间等。
权利要求
1.一种CTTB信号与卫星定位信号相结合的定位方法,通过接收电视信号发射站发出 的地面数字电视信号和定位卫星发出的GPS(也可是其它定位卫星)信号确定接收机的空 间位置,其特征是在单频网环境下多电视信号发射站或只有单一电视信号发射站环境下 都可以实现和GPS卫星(也可是其它定位卫星)的联合定位,提高在城市市区等可见GPS 卫星(也可是其它定位卫星)数目不足情况下的定位概率,提高可定位情况下的定位精度, 系统主要包括以下工作流程1)根据接收机存储的位置信息、接收机存储器存储的地理信息确定接收机所在城市、 所在城市各频段发射CTTB信号的模式、所在城市电视信号发射站个数、相应的位置坐标及 相对于接收机的方向;2)通过天线捕获GPS卫星(也可是其他定位卫星)发射的射频信号,分辨可见卫星发 出的信号;通过天线接收某一频段CTTB信号并记录信号的到达方向,信号的到达时间;3)对捕获的GPS卫星(也可是其他定位卫星)信号进行跟踪,提取导航电文,解码导航 电文,确定卫星位置、速度和时钟参数,按照传统GPS(也可是其他卫星定位系统)接收机的 工作原理实现信号从卫星到接收机传输时间的测量;4)通过接收CTTB信号的不同方向,判定其发射站,当可见卫星数目和电视发射站数目 之和大于等于4时执行步骤幻,当可见卫星数目和电视发射站数目之和小于4时执行步骤 2)或通知不可定位;5)确定CTTB信号帧在电视信号发射站和接收机之间的传播时间;6)将GPS卫星(也可是其他定位卫星)信号到接收机的传输时间,及电视信号发射站 和接收机之间CTTB信号帧的传播时间与光速相乘获得伪距值,将幻和幻中获得的信息同 伪距值一起带入位置、速度、时间估算方程,计算出接收机的空间位置坐标,并换算为接收 机的定位信息,包括位置、速度和时间。
2.根据权利要求1所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特征 是所述的接收机存储的位置信息可以是断电前的位置,或者上一次定位的位置,或者在开 阔区域通过GPS (也可是其他卫星定位系统)得到的位置信息。
3.根据权利要求1所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特征 是所述的天线接收某一频段CTTB信号,其频段的选择可以根据接收机天线的接收频率范 围、特定频段CTTB信号帧的帧模式以及各频段的噪声情况进行综合判断选取。
4.根据权利要求1所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特征 是所述的确定CTTB信号帧在发射站和接收机之间的传播时间,采用的方法是对不同方向 到达的CTTB信号确定其信号帧帧头的接收时间和发射时间,用帧头接收时间减去发射时 间,即可得到CTTB信号帧在电视信号发射站和接收机之间的传播时间。
5.根据权利要求4所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特征 是所述的信号帧帧头的接收时间的测量方法为将接收到的CTTB信号与本地PN序列进行 相关,相关得到峰值的位置即为信号帧帧头所在位置,根据接收信号到帧头位置之间移位 符号的个数确定接收到帧头的时间,其数值为接收信号的时间加上移动符号个数与符号长 度1/7. 56 μ s的乘积所得之和。
6.根据权利要求4所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特征 是所述的信号帧帧头的发射时间的测量方法为数值k与信号帧帧长度(如果天线接收频段CTTB信号为模式一信号帧长度为555. 56 μ s,模式二为578. 7 μ s,模式三为625 μ s)的 乘积即为信号帧在电视发射时间。
7.根据权利要求6所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特征 是所述的本地PN序列具体为若天线接收频段CTTB模式为模式一或模式三时,由于帧头 PN序列存在相位变化,因此无法直接确定用来与接收信号进行相关运算的本地PN序列,需 要令数值k对超帧中信号帧个数(如果天线接收频段CTTB信号为模式一此数为225,模式 三为200)进行取模运算,得到的数值即为信号帧帧头序号,进而根据帧头序号确定天线接 收频段CTTB模式所对应的帧头PN序列,并按照其信号帧模式对其进行前同步和后同步的 循环扩展,得到本地PN序列;若天线接收频段CTTB模式为模式二,由于不存在帧头PN序列 相位变化,因此可以直接确定帧头PN序列,由于该帧头PN序列无需进行循环扩展,帧头PN 序列可直接作为本地PN序列。
8.根据权利要求6、7所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特 征是所述的数值k为计算CTTB信号到达时刻与CTTB日帧复位参考时间(如北京时间 00:00:00AM)之间整数信号帧长度(如果天线接收频段CTTB信号为模式一信号帧长度为 555. 56 μ s,模式二为578. 7 μ s,模式三为625 μ s)的个数,对此数加1所得的结果。
9.根据权利要求1至8所述的一种CTTB信号与卫星定位信号相结合的定位方法,其特 征是适用于所有使用CTTB作为地面数字电视标准的国家和地区。
全文摘要
本发明公开一种通过接收GPS卫星(也可是其他定位卫星)信号和CTTB数字电视信号确定接收机空间位置的定位方法。接收机通过接收GPS卫星(也可是其他定位卫星)的信号和电视信号发射站发射的CTTB信号,利用GPS卫星(也可是其他定位卫星)和电视信号发射站的位置、GPS卫星(也可是其他定位卫星)和电视信号发射站与接收机之间的伪距,实现接收机的空间位置的定位。它能够提高可见GPS卫星(也可是其他定位卫星)数目不足四颗时的定位概率和在可定位情况下实现更高精度的定位。同时它即可应用于单频网多电视信号发射站的情况,又可用于非单频网单电视信号发射站的情况。
文档编号G01S19/52GK102096085SQ20091022903
公开日2011年6月15日 申请日期2009年12月9日 优先权日2009年12月9日
发明者吴虹, 张南, 徐宁, 李雯琦 申请人:南开大学
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1